The only gauge I found to be wrong was the boost pressure. It has never registered more than about 5PSI. Scangauge shows it correctly.
Other gauges are pretty accurate including the fuel gauge.
Before I got the SG, I was keeping detailed records on fuel. My manual calculations revealed between 8 & 9 MPG. After a few trips with the Scangauge, it agreed pretty closely with my calculations so now I just rely on SG.
I sent my X-Gauge listing to Scangauge and they responded with 3 additional X-Gauges:
Cruise Control set speed (MPH)
Transmission output shaft speed (RPM)
Power Take Off Set speed (RPM)
